Open file format

Last updated

An open file format is a file format for storing digital data, [1] [2] defined by an openly published specification usually maintained by a standards organization, and which can be used and implemented by anyone. An open file format is licensed with an open license. [3] [4] [ failed verification ][ contradictory ] For example, an open format can be implemented by both proprietary and free and open-source software, using the typical software licenses used by each. In contrast to open file formats, closed file formats are considered trade secrets.

Contents

Depending on the definition, the specification of an open format may require a fee to access or, very rarely, contain other restrictions. [5] The range of meanings is similar to that of the term open standard.

Specific definitions

Sun Microsystems

Sun Microsystems defined the criteria for open formats as follows: [1]

UK government

In 2012 the UK Government created the policy Open Standards Principles, stating that the Open Standards Principles apply to every aspect of government IT and that Government technology must remain open to everyone. [6] They have seven principles for selecting open standards for use in government, following these principals many open formats were adopted, notably Open Document Format (ODF). The seven principles for selecting open standards for use in the UK government are:

US government

Within the framework of Open Government Initiative, the federal government of the United States adopted the Open Government Directive, according to which: "An open format is one that is platform independent, machine readable, and made available to the public without restrictions that would impede the re-use of that information". [7]

State of Minnesota

The State of Minnesota defines the criteria for open, XML-based file formats as follows: [8]

Commonwealth of Massachusetts

The Commonwealth of Massachusetts "defines open formats as specifications for data file formats that are based on an underlying open standard, developed by an open community, affirmed and maintained by a standards body and are fully documented and publicly available." [9]

The Enterprise Technical Reference Model (ETRM) classifies four formats as "Open Formats":

  1. OASIS Open Document Format For Office Applications (OpenDocument) v. 1.1
  2. Ecma-376 Office Open XML Formats (Open XML)
  3. Hypertext Document Format v. 4.01
  4. Plain Text Format

The Linux Information Project

According to The Linux Information Project, the term open format should refer to "any format that is published for anyone to read and study but which may or may not be encumbered by patents, copyrights or other restrictions on use" [5] – as opposed to a free format which is not encumbered by any copyrights, patents, trademarks or other restrictions.

Examples of open formats

Open formats (in the royalty-free and free access sense) include: [5]

The following formats are open (royalty-free with a one-time fee on the standard):

See also

Related Research Articles

<span class="mw-page-title-main">PDF</span> Portable Document Format, a digital file format

Portable Document Format (PDF), standardized as ISO 32000, is a file format developed by Adobe in 1992 to present documents, including text formatting and images, in a manner independent of application software, hardware, and operating systems. Based on the PostScript language, each PDF file encapsulates a complete description of a fixed-layout flat document, including the text, fonts, vector graphics, raster images and other information needed to display it. PDF has its roots in "The Camelot Project" initiated by Adobe co-founder John Warnock in 1991. PDF was standardized as ISO 32000 in 2008. The last edition as ISO 32000-2:2020 was published in December 2020.

The Organization for the Advancement of Structured Information Standards is a nonprofit consortium that works on the development, convergence, and adoption of projects - both open standards and open source - for Computer security, blockchain, Internet of things (IoT), emergency management, cloud computing, legal data exchange, energy, content technologies, and other areas.

An open standard is a standard that is openly accessible and usable by anyone. It is also a common prerequisite that open standards use an open license that provides for extensibility. Typically, anybody can participate in their development due to their inherently open nature. There is no single definition, and interpretations vary with usage. Examples of open standards include the GSM, 4G, and 5G standards that allow most modern mobile phones to work world-wide.

X3D is a set of royalty-free ISO/IEC standards for declaratively representing 3D computer graphics. X3D includes multiple graphics file formats, programming-language API definitions, and run-time specifications for both delivery and integration of interactive network-capable 3D data. X3D version 4.0 has been approved by Web3D Consortium, and is under final review by ISO/IEC as a revised International Standard (IS).

The Open Document Architecture (ODA) and interchange format is a free and open international standard document file format maintained by the ITU-T to replace all proprietary document file formats. ODA is detailed in the standards documents CCITT T.411-T.424, which is equivalent to ISO/IEC 8613.

The Open Document Format for Office Applications (ODF), also known as OpenDocument, standardized as ISO 26300, is an open file format for word processing documents, spreadsheets, presentations and graphics and using ZIP-compressed XML files. It was developed with the aim of providing an open, XML-based file format specification for office applications.

<span class="mw-page-title-main">JSON</span> Open standard file format and data interchange

JSON is an open standard file format and data interchange format that uses human-readable text to store and transmit data objects consisting of attribute–value pairs and arrays. It is a commonly used data format with diverse uses in electronic data interchange, including that of web applications with servers.

The Extensible Metadata Platform (XMP) is an ISO standard, originally created by Adobe Systems Inc., for the creation, processing and interchange of standardized and custom metadata for digital documents and data sets.

A metadata registry is a central location in an organization where metadata definitions are stored and maintained in a controlled method.

Open XML Paper Specification is an open specification for a page description language and a fixed-document format. Microsoft developed it as the XML Paper Specification (XPS). In June 2009, Ecma International adopted it as international standard ECMA-388.

JT is an openly-published ISO-standardized 3D CAD data exchange format used for product visualization, collaboration, digital mockups, and other purposes. It was developed by Siemens.

Office Open XML is a zipped, XML-based file format developed by Microsoft for representing spreadsheets, charts, presentations and word processing documents. Ecma International standardized the initial version as ECMA-376. ISO and IEC standardized later versions as ISO/IEC 29500.

The following article details governmental and other organizations from around the world who are in the process of evaluating the suitability of using (adopting) OpenDocument, an open document file format for saving and exchanging office documents that may be edited.

A proprietary file format is a file format of a company, organization, or individual that contains data that is ordered and stored according to a particular encoding-scheme, designed by the company or organization to be secret, such that the decoding and interpretation of this stored data is easily accomplished only with particular software or hardware that the company itself has developed. The specification of the data encoding format is not released, or underlies non-disclosure agreements. A proprietary format can also be a file format whose encoding is in fact published, but is restricted through licences such that only the company itself or licensees may use it. In contrast, an open format is a file format that is published and free to be used by everybody.

ISO 13399 is an international technical standard by ISO for the computer-interpretable representation and exchange of industrial product data about cutting tools and toolholders. The objective is to provide a mechanism capable of describing product data regarding cutting tools, independent from any particular system. The nature of this description makes it suitable not only for neutral file exchange, but also as a basis for implementing and sharing product databases and archiving, regarding cutting tools.

The following is a comparison of e-book formats used to create and publish e-books.

The Office Open XML file formats, also known as OOXML, were standardised between December 2006 and November 2008, first by the Ecma International consortium, and subsequently, after a contentious standardization process, by the ISO/IEC's Joint Technical Committee 1.

The Office Open XML file formats are a set of file formats that can be used to represent electronic office documents. There are formats for word processing documents, spreadsheets and presentations as well as specific formats for material such as mathematical formulas, graphics, bibliographies etc.

<span class="mw-page-title-main">.NET Framework</span> Software platform developed by Microsoft

The .NET Framework is a proprietary software framework developed by Microsoft that runs primarily on Microsoft Windows. It was the predominant implementation of the Common Language Infrastructure (CLI) until being superseded by the cross-platform .NET project. It includes a large class library called Framework Class Library (FCL) and provides language interoperability across several programming languages. Programs written for .NET Framework execute in a software environment named the Common Language Runtime (CLR). The CLR is an application virtual machine that provides services such as security, memory management, and exception handling. As such, computer code written using .NET Framework is called "managed code". FCL and CLR together constitute the .NET Framework.

References

  1. 1 2 Open Document Format for Office Applications (OpenDocument) v1.0 – OASIS Standard, 1 May 2005
  2. "Open Format Definition". techterms.com. Retrieved 24 March 2022.
  3. "Open Format Definition - Open Definition - Defining Open in Open Data, Open Content and Open Knowledge". opendefinition.org. Retrieved 24 March 2022.
  4. "open format - open data handbook".
  5. 1 2 3 "Free File Format Definition". LINFO.org. Retrieved 11 February 2007.
  6. 1 2 "Open Standards principles". Gov.UK. 5 April 2018. Retrieved 10 September 2021. UKOpenGovernmentLicence.svg Text was copied from this source, which is available under an Open Government Licence v3.0. © Crown copyright.
  7. Orszag, Peter R. (8 December 2009). "Open Government Directive". The White House.
  8. Updegrove, Andy (6 February 2007). "Meanwhile, Deep Down in Texas: An Open Format Bill is Filed". ConsortiumInfo.org. Retrieved 23 November 2023.
  9. "Major Revision of Massachusetts Enterprise Technical Reference Model (ETRM)." Robin Cover, Editor – 3 July 2007 – Cover Pages.